Mandate: At the CCTC, theatre creators and scholars alike explore new theatrical creation and dramaturgy. We bring together independent artists, theatre companies and researchers to examine and experiment with new approaches to creation, development and production and exchange information about their processes and discoveries.
- Creation: We develop new Canadian scripts with workshops and conventional dramaturgical support for playwrights. We also extend our support of theatrical creation, embracing innovative uses of multimedia, inter-disciplinary and non-text based approaches, and other new creative processes.
- We provide space, time and expertise, forge partnerships to generate discoveries in theatrical settings, and explore the diversity of Canadian theatre.
- Production: We facilitate readings, workshops, and new theatrical productions on our own as well as cooperatively with other Canadian theatre companies.
- Scholarship: We engage artists, researchers, dramaturgs and scholars in a critical discourse on the rapidly expanding field of theatrical creation and production

The CCTC works in partnership and collaboration with theatre creators and scholars across the country to bring new Canadian work to production or production readiness and to generate research on new theatre and the creative process. These creative and academic relationships are forged at the Centre’s invitation or by independent solicitation of the CCTC
